Blame tests/basic/posixonly.t
|
Packit Service |
e080da |
#!/bin/bash
|
|
Packit Service |
e080da |
|
|
Packit Service |
e080da |
. $(dirname $0)/../include.rc
|
|
Packit Service |
e080da |
. $(dirname $0)/../volume.rc
|
|
Packit Service |
e080da |
|
|
Packit Service |
e080da |
cleanup;
|
|
Packit Service |
e080da |
|
|
Packit Service |
e080da |
TEST mkdir -p $B0/posixonly
|
|
Packit Service |
e080da |
cat > $B0/posixonly.vol <
|
|
Packit Service |
e080da |
volume poisxonly
|
|
Packit Service |
e080da |
type storage/posix
|
|
Packit Service |
e080da |
option directory $B0/posixonly
|
|
Packit Service |
e080da |
end-volume
|
|
Packit Service |
e080da |
EOF
|
|
Packit Service |
e080da |
|
|
Packit Service |
e080da |
TEST glusterfs -f $B0/posixonly.vol $M0;
|
|
Packit Service |
e080da |
|
|
Packit Service |
e080da |
TEST touch $M0/filename;
|
|
Packit Service |
e080da |
TEST stat $M0/filename;
|
|
Packit Service |
e080da |
TEST mkdir $M0/dirname;
|
|
Packit Service |
e080da |
TEST stat $M0/dirname;
|
|
Packit Service |
e080da |
TEST touch $M0/dirname/filename;
|
|
Packit Service |
e080da |
TEST stat $M0/dirname/filename;
|
|
Packit Service |
e080da |
TEST ln $M0/dirname/filename $M0/dirname/linkname;
|
|
Packit Service |
e080da |
TEST chown 100:100 $M0/dirname/filename;
|
|
Packit Service |
e080da |
TEST chown 100:100 $M0/dirname;
|
|
Packit Service |
e080da |
TEST rm -rf $M0/filename $M0/dirname;
|
|
Packit Service |
e080da |
|
|
Packit Service |
e080da |
EXPECT_WITHIN $UMOUNT_TIMEOUT "Y" force_umount $M0
|
|
Packit Service |
e080da |
|
|
Packit Service |
e080da |
cleanup;
|